osaf Posted January 17 Share #14 Posted January 17 Am 15.1.2025 um 10:20 schrieb ktmrider2: May have to visit Leica Park as well. You should do it. It's worth it. Travelling by train ... Regional trains from/to Frankfurt are an option. Depending where you come from Limburg (a stop of the ICE / high-speed train Frankfurt-Cologne) or Kassel (a stop of the ICE Frankfurt-Hamburg) are alternatives. All about 2 hrs .... I think Wetzlar and Leitz Park are definitely worth a visit, particularly in this anniversary year : Leitz-Park (Museum, Tour, Shop (they rent you anything you want for a fess hours); you can eat and sleep at the Hotel on the site which is nice), and Downtown Wetzlar : worth a visit, particularly if you are not european, as it is a very typical. German Trains are not what Germany do best in my experience (no offense to anybody) : they work well, but you need to anticipate they are not always perfectly on time (and thus, take enough time between 2 trains). An alternative could be to travel long distances by Train, ie to Frankfurt, and rent a Car from Frankfurt to Wetzlar (it is a short drive <1h) ?
